How To Cook Air Fryer Pork Shu Mai. Preheat your air fryer to 350 degrees, using the air fryer setting, for 2 to 4 minutes. Then place your frozen pork shu mai into the air fryer basket, and spray with a bit of cooking spray. Which will help them crisp up. Set the temperature to 350 and cook for 10 to 12 minutes until they are fully cooked.

Alternatively, if you do this traditional Chinese way, steam them with a pot. If you don't have a steamer, you can use a saucepan wide enough to hold a metal strainer around the rim, (strainer shouldn't touch the bottom). Add about an inch of water to bottom of the pan, place the strainer over the pan, fill with shumai, steam for 10-15 minutes.

Nutritional information for Trader Joe's Pork Shu Mai. Per 5 pieces (141g): 290 Calories | 17g Fat | 21g Carbohydrates | 1g Fiber | 6g Sugar | 13g Protein | 350mg Sodium | 45mg Cholesterol | 0mg Potassium.
